The EB-0 is known for its short scale feel and powerful “mudbucker” pickup, delivering deep, warm tones that sit perfectly in a mix. This example retains its core vintage character but will require a neck reset (see photos) to reach proper playability.
Project condition. The neck angle is off and will need a proper reset. Cosmetic wear throughout checking, dings, and finish wear consistent with age. Hardware and components show typical vintage aging. Sold strictly as-is with no returns.
